The Science Behind Tea and Weight Loss

Several scientific studies have shown the potential weight loss benefits of tea. One study found that green tea extract increased metabolism and fat oxidation in participants. Another study showed that oolong tea reduced body weight and BMI in obese people. The catechins in green tea have also been shown to reduce inflammation and improve blood sugar levels. Tea can boost metabolism, increase fat burning, and reduce appetite, making it a viable option for those looking to lose weight.

Tea vs. Coffee: Which is Better for Weight Loss?

While both tea and coffee can aid in weight loss, there are some differences to consider. Tea typically has less caffeine than coffee, making it a better choice for those sensitive to caffeine. Coffee has been shown to suppress appetite, but the effects may not last as long as those of tea. Additionally, tea contains antioxidants and compounds that have anti-inflammatory properties, which can benefit overall health. The choice between tea and coffee ultimately comes down to personal preference and tolerance for caffeine.
